What Buyers Should Know Before Buying Commercial Doors from China
Key considerations when importing:
- Lead times typically range 30-60 days
- Minimum order quantities may apply
- Shipping costs impact total pricing
- Local building codes must be verified
Case Study: A Chicago hotel chain saved 35% on doors by working directly with a Guangdong manufacturer, though they needed to account for additional 2 weeks for customs clearance.
Types of Commercial Doors
The main categories include:
Glass Doors
Ideal for storefronts and offices, offering visibility and natural light.
Steel Security Doors
Used in banks, data centers, and high-security areas.
Fire-Rated Doors
Mandatory for corridors and stairwells in most commercial buildings.
Overhead Sectional Doors
Common in warehouses and loading docks.

Commercial Doors Q & A
Q: What's the average lifespan of commercial doors?
A: Quality doors last 15-30 years with proper maintenance, depending on materials and usage.
Q: Can I get custom-sized doors from China?
A: Most manufacturers accept custom orders, though lead times may increase by 10-15 days.
Q: How do fire-rated doors differ from standard models?
A: They contain special cores and seals that withstand high temperatures for specified durations (typically 60-180 minutes).
Q: What's the best material for coastal areas?
A: Aluminum or fiberglass doors resist saltwater corrosion better than steel.
Q: Are automatic doors energy-efficient?
A: Modern models with quick-close features can reduce HVAC loss by up to 40% compared to manual doors.
